{"data":{"id":"us/22-cfr-92.87","jurisdiction":"us","citation":"22 CFR 92.87","heading":"Consular responsibility for serving orders to show cause.","body":"Officers of the Foreign Service are required to serve orders to show cause issued in contempt proceedings on a person who has failed or neglected to appear in answer to a subpoena served in accordance with the provisions of § 92.86. (Section 1, 62 Stat. 949; 28 U.S.C. 1784.)","path":["Title 22—Foreign Relations","CHAPTER I—DEPARTMENT OF STATE","SUBCHAPTER J—LEGAL AND RELATED SERVICES","PART 92—NOTARIAL AND RELATED SERVICES"],"source_url":"https://www.ecfr.gov/api/versioner/v1/full/2026-08-25/title-22.xml","current_through":"2026-08-25","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-08-27T02:24:49Z","sha256":"be09d4fc503531a3dc9e80a1217bdf8248085a625f0e0692545fe52bfafd8d8b","source_id":"us-cfr","stale":true,"prev":"us/22-cfr-92.86","next":"us/22-cfr-92.88"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
